Tourism properties, theme parks and infrastructure projects built by the Vietnamese developer won a total of 13 awards at the global finale of World Travel Awards 2019.

(Muscat, Oman, November 28, 2019) – The Vietnamese developer Sun Group scooped a total of 13 awards at the 26th annual World Travel Awards (WTA) ceremony in the beautiful Sultanate of Oman.

This major haul made Sun Group one of the big winners at the global finale of WTA, often described as ‘the Oscars of the world travel industry’ and capped off a stellar award-winning year – last month, the developer also lifted no less than 17 awards at the World Travel Awards (WTA) Asia-Oceania held on October 12, 2019 on Phu Quoc Island.

At a lavish gala ceremony in Oman, representatives of the group were presented with awards for two entertainment and resort complexes (Sun World Ba Na Hills and Sun World Fansipan Legend), and one transport infrastructure project (Van Don International Airport) as well as six luxury hotels and resorts.

Located in the former hill station of Sapa in northern Vietnam, Hotel de la Coupole MGallery, created by the architect Bill Bensley, was named “World’s Leading Design Hotel 2019”. Described as a “whimsical new luxury hotel” that put the spotlight on Vietnam's mountainous north” by CNN, this evocative 5-star accommodation named “World’s Leading Iconic Hotel” from WTA.

In Central Vietnam, In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ula Resort – a perennial favorite at the WTA – was named “World’s Leading Resort Architecture Design 2019” and its premier restaurant, La Maison 1888, was chosen as the “World’s Leading Fine Dining Hotel Restaurant 2019". Also named the “World’s Leading Luxury Beach Resort 2019”, the resort beat off some seriously impressive competition from luxury resorts such as Emirates Palace in Abu Dhabi, UAE, Four Seasons Resort Koh Samui in Thailand, Sani Resort in Greek, InterContinental Bali Resort in Indonesia, Forte Village Resort in Italy, and many others.
 
Meanwhile, another Sun Group development, Premier Village Danang Resort, located on My Khe Beach, a stunning location in Central Vietnam, was named “World's Leading Family Villa Resort 2019” at the awards ceremony. 
 
The developer was further delighted as Mercure Danang French Village Bana Hills was honored as "World's Leading Themed Resort 2019". Taking inspiration from the classic architectural traditions of France, the hotel offers 470 rooms with seven buildings named after seven famous French cities (from Paris and Lyon to Strasbourg and Marseille). Every room is imbued with elegant interiors and views of a replica French Village.
 

Offering world class services in a truly heavenly setting, JW Marriott Phu Quoc Emerald Bay was named “World's Leading Resort & Spa 2019” and “World's Leading Luxury Wedding Resort 2019” at WTA 2019. The sumptuous accommodation another masterpiece of resort design dreamed up by Bill Bensley.  

Also developed by Sun Group on Phu Quoc Island, Premier Village Phu Quoc Resort was named “World's Leading Beach Villa Resort 2019”. Nestled on a lush peninsula with beach and ocean views to all sides, the property's incredible location offers guests a truly unique experience as they can watch both the serene sunrise and a stunning sunset in the exact same spot.

Along with all of the awards for its hotels and resorts, two major tourism and entertainment complexes developed by Sun Group in Sapa and Danang – namely, Sun World Fansipan Legend and Sun World Ba Na Hills – have also been honored as “World's Leading Cultural Tourist Attraction 2019” and “World’s Leading Cable Car Ride 2019” respectively by WTA.

Last but not least, Sun Group’s Van Don International Airport – the first ever privately developed airport in Vietnam – overcome rivals from the US, UK, Spain, India and Singapore to land the highly prestigious prize of “World’s Leading New Airport 2019”.

This is not the first time Sun Group’s projects have been honored by WTA. Since the In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ula Resort was named the "World’s Leading Luxury Resort 2014", Sun Group has gone on to develop numerous award-winning resorts and attractions, enhancing Vietnam’s reputation as one of the most attractive destinations for tourism in the region and putting it on the world’s tourism map.

According to the Pacific Asia Travel Association’s (PATA) latest quarterly tourism monitor, Vietnam was listed among the top 10 destinations welcoming the largest number of arrivals in the Asia-Pacific region, and ranked fourth in Southeast Asia in the number of international arrivals in the first half of 2019. About the World Travel Awards

Founded in 1993, the World Travel Awards are designed to acknowledge, reward and celebrate excellence across all key sectors of the travel, tourism and hospitality industries. Hailed as “The Oscars of the Travel Industry” by the Wall Street Journal, the WTA brand is recognized globally as the ultimate hallmark of industry excellence.
